[우테코 7기 백엔드 회고] 4주차 편의점
·
회고록
현재 우테코 프리코스의 과제가 끝난 시점에서 1주일이 흘렀다. 4주차에 대한 코드를 다시 보면서 그 때 당시의 문제점들과 배운점들을 토대로 회고 및 느낀점을 작성해보고자 한다. 기능 요구 사항기능 요구사항을 대충 훑어만 봐도 어마어마하다... 이걸 보는 순간 머리가 지끈거리면서 어떻게 구현해나아가야 할지에 대해서 머릿속이 복잡해져나갔었다.게다가 출력에 대한 포맷을 보면 프로젝트 파일에서 products.md 파일과, promotions.md 파일이 있기 때문에 기타 추가 사항 및 변경사항들은 md 파일에서 이루어지며, md 파일에 대한 포맷이 변경될 경우 이를 사용하는 애플리케이션에서는 추가적인 변경사항이 없어야 완벽하게 구현했다고 볼 수 있다. 처음에 이러한 부분을 놓쳐서 다시 설계했었다.비즈니스 로직..
[우테코 7기 백엔드 회고] 1주차 미션 문자열 계산기
·
회고록
이번에 우테코를 지원하면서 떨리는 마음으로 프리코스 1주차 미션을 받았다. 기능 요구사항에 맞게 구현 했다고는 하지만 여전히 코드를 보면 리팩토링할 여지는 너무 많은 코드였던거 같다.. 이미 제출한 시점에도 부족한 부분이 너무나 많다고 느낀다. 애초에 해당 미션을 수행하는데에 있어서 걸리는 시간은 하루도 채 걸리지 않은 거같다. 근데 미션 제출기한이 1주일이나 되다보니... 뭔가 1주일이라는 시간을 준 이유가 있지 않을까... 하면서 코드를 보고 또 보고 하게 되었다.이러다 보니 뭔가 어차피 제출할 코드이지만 뭔가 애정이 가게 되고 계속해서 보다보니 바꿀 여지가 있는 코드가 보였달까....기능 요구 사항메인 비즈니스 로직import java.util.List;public class Calculator {..
cheolhyeon
'우테코 회고록' 태그의 글 목록